I have definitely used a poncho liner in a poncho before. But it was much more common in Korea or Germany for soldiers to take a poncho liner and wet weather top down to a seamstress and have them use the poncho liner as a liner for the wet weather top. They would cut it up and sew it into the wet weather top and that made for a terrific cold weather jacket, warmer than a field jacket and better rain proofing. I also was a great fan of the old Army Parka, without the liner. It fit very loose and non-binding, light weight, and created a nice vapor barrier in cooler weather. And while no more water proof than a field jacket, it did dry out faster, so there was that.

3:26 if your “poncho” is essentially a tarp, you can route the drawstrings of the poncho/tarp through the eyelets of the unzipped poncho liner to make a “ranger roll” where you have the waterproof (your experience may vary) tarp exterior and the heat insulation of the poncho liner. Draping it over you to block light escaping when doing map checks at night is also a reason for a ranger roll… if you’re into that sort of thing

With a sling attached, you adjust it so you can press out against the sling to stabilize the pistol. Israeli EP operators wear a lanyard with a loop around their neck. After drawing their Glock, they hook their thumb through the loop and use it to stabilize the pistol for better accuracy. It's a great, simple system that has been around a long time.
